4. When encountering a vehicle in front ascending on a mountainous road covered with ice and snow, what should the motor vehicle driver do?
A. Ascend after the vehicle in front passes the slope
B. Overtake the vehicle in front swiftly and drive on
C. Overtake the vehicle in front with a slow speed and drive on
D. Follow the vehicle in front closely
Answer: A
5. When driving on an expressway which of the following statements is correct?
A. Drivers may stop to pick up or drop off passengers in the emergency lane
B. Drives may load or unload cargo in the emergency lane
C. Drives may overtake other vehicles or stop in the deceleration or acceleration lane
D. Drives are prohibited from driving or stopping in the emergency lane in a non-emergency case
Answer: D

13. Which of the following is a bad driving habit?
A. Using lights in accordance with relevant rules
B. Carrying both vehicle and driving license
C. Discarding rubbish from the side window
D. Follow the guidance of the traffic signals
Answer: C
14. When there is a braking failure on a downhill road, if there is no favorable terrain or opportunity to stop the vehicle, the driver should drop gear by one position or two positions, and control the speed by taking advantage of the braking role of the engine.
A. Right
B. Wrong
Answer: A

19. Mr. Ran drove his car from 6am until 11 am without rest, falling down a steep 8.5-meter ridge at one side of a highway 1 km from Xunan Road in Xuahan County, killing 13 people and injuring 9. Which of the following law-breaking acts did Mr Ran commit?
A. Speeding
B. Driving not in accordance with the traffic markings
C. Exceeding carrying capacity
D. Fatigued driving
Answer: D
20. When there is a sudden braking failure on a downhill road, what should be done by the driver?
A. Driving to an emergency lane and reducing speed to stop
B. Dropping the gear by two positions
C. Changing to the reverse gear to force the vehicle to stop
D. Reducing speed by pulling up the handbrake
Answer: A
21. When there is a braking failure on a downhill road the driver should change the gear to one position or two positions lower, and control the speed by taking advantage of the braking role of the engine.
A. Right
B. Wrong
Answer: A
22. When driving on a long downhill road, which is the best way to control driving speed?
A. Coast in neutral gear
B. Depress the clutch and coast
C. Use the engine to brake
D. Depress the brake pedal continuously
Answer: C

24. What is the function of ABS during emergency braking?
A. Shortening the braking distance
B. Keeping steering capacity of the motor vehicle
C. Relief the braking inertia
D. Controlling directions automatically
Answer: B
